Just and FYI, Hyundai and Kia are now the same company. That means, what is in a Kia should be the same as what is in a Hyundai (Amanti = XG350; Optima = Sonata; and the list goes on). Although Kia has gotten better over the years, they still have a long way to go. In the here and now, I personally recommend neither Kia nor Hyundai!

For now, Kia and Hyundai reminds me of the way Toyota, Honda and Nissan (then Datsun) were like back in the 1970s, when they were just beginning to get in the American auto market. They sold cars that were very cheap, but completely unreliable. Those cars broke down and fell apart just like the way Kias are today.

Today, the Japanese auto makers not only make better and reliable cars, at times, they happen to cost more than a Cadillac! As for Kia and Hyundai, well, they still have a long way to go ... and if they do not improve -- you're right that the company should be destroyed!
